BYU receiver Hoffman suspended for tonight’s game
main image
PROVO -- BYU head football coach Bronco Mendenhall announced senior wide receiver Cody Hoffman has been suspended for tonight’s game against Middle Tennessee due to a violation of team rules.
Hoffman’s suspension is for one game. Hoffman leads BYU with 10 receptions and 171 yards in two games played. He missed BYU’s season opener at Virginia due to a hamstring injury.
BYU (1-2) hosts Middle Tennessee (3-1) at 7 p.m. MT on ESPNU.
